Ingredients
• 1 tbsp / 15 ml Olive Oil
• 2 lbs / 900 g Pork Sirloin, sliced into 1-inch cubes
• 2 tsp / 6 g Garlic Powder
• 2 tsp / 4 g Ground Cumin
• ¼ tsp / 1.5 g Salt, or to taste
• 16 oz / 450 g Keto Tomatillo Salsa
Instructions
1. Directions
2. Set your Instant Pot to the SAUTE function and add the olive oil to heat.2. While the pot heats, toss the pork cubes in a bowl with the garlic powder, cumin, and salt until evenly coated.3. Carefully add the seasoned pork to the hot pot in a single layer. Sear for 2-3 minutes per side until browned all over. Work in batches if necessary to avoid overcrowding the pot.4. Return all the browned pork to the pot and pour the tomatillo salsa over the top. Do not stir.5. Secure the lid, turn the steam release valve to the SEALING position, and cook on HIGH pressure for 45 minutes.6. Once the timer finishes, carefully perform a quick pressure release by moving the valve to the VENTING position.7. Open the lid once the pin has dropped. The pork will be incredibly tender. Shred with two forks directly in the pot, serve hot, and enjoy!

Pro Tips
• For extra flavor and tenderness, substitute pork sirloin with pork shoulder (pork butt). You may need to add 10-15 minutes to the pressure cooking time.
• Serve this spicy pork in lettuce wraps, over cauliflower rice, or with a side of steamed green beans to keep it low-carb.
• Adjust the heat by choosing a mild, medium, or hot tomatillo salsa. For an extra kick, add a sliced jalapeño to the pot with the salsa.
• If the sauce is too thin after cooking, remove the pork and turn the Instant Pot back to SAUTE. Let the sauce simmer for 5-7 minutes until it reduces and thickens.
